American longevity researcher Dan Buettner uses the term “Blue Zone” to define five regions worldwide where people live the longest, healthiest lives. These zones—Okinawa in Japan, Sardinia in Italy, Nicoya in Costa Rica, Ikaria in Greece, and Loma Linda in the United States—are distinguished by simple lifestyle traits that promote longevity, such as loyal social connections, natural movement, and plant-based diets. The Festes Majors are summer festivals held in the villages of Andorra. Each festival is unique to the village, with its own distinct style.
